How to mop a floor fast:
The best way to mop floors is with a microfiber flat mop system like I'm using here, the microfiber mop removes the residues from the floor quickly and easily and then you simply throw the pads in the washing machine after you use them meaning there are no sticky residues and no streaks left on your floor.

how to use a microfiber flat mop:
To use a microfiber flat mop properly follow the steps in the tutorial. Depending on the size of the area you want to flat mop you're going to need on average about 10 heads so you don't run out. Depending on how dirty the floor is you should use one flat mop head about every 10 square foot, less if the floor is pretty clean.
